Who is Rockslide?

Rockslide crashes onto the scene in Kurt Busiek's Astro City #4 (1996), a creation of the legendary team of Kurt Busiek and Brent E. Anderson — architects of one of comics' most celebrated and humanistic superhero universes. A Modern Age figure, this character inhabits the richly layered world of Astro City, sharing its pages with iconic inhabitants like the Confessor, Crackerjack, and Jack-in-the-Box. With appearances spanning nearly two decades and touchpoints across both Astro City: Confession and New X-Men, Rockslide is a compact but intriguing piece of a beloved corner of comics history worth tracking down.
